It is with great sadness that Uxbridge College wish to pay their respects to a magnificent teacher and manager who sadly died suddenly and unexpectedly on Wednesday 25 April, aged 59 years.
Rachel Davies, Principal, said: "As a well-established member of staff, Ian was a 'one off'. His commitment, loyalty and dedication to his students and his staff were unsurpassed. He had high expectations and never wavered from his deepest principles. He will be sorely missed."
Ian had worked at Uxbridge College since 1997 as a manager and Head of School for Creative Studies. His experience and professional life spanned more than 28 years in further education, having first followed a career in the fashion industry. Following the achievement of a BA in Fashion and Textiles, Ian went on to work in the fashion industry before taking a post graduate teaching qualification.
During his further education career, he also held positions at the South East Essex College and St Martin's College of Art & Design. He was a respected manager, held in high esteem by staff and students, dedicated to the success of all and a most compassionate man.
Ian's funeral was held at West Norwood Crematorium in South London on 4 May.
